    LEARNING MOTIVATION: A SELF-DETERMINATION THEORY PERSPECTIVE
    (CEP USM, 2014) Farah-Jarjoura, Basma
    In recent years, a renewed interest in raising motivation amongst students in academic settings has emerged. This has led to a great deal of research that aimed to shed light on diverse theories of motivation, in order to increase the learning motivation amongst students. Self-Determination Theory (SDT) is one of the most comprehensive and empirically supported theories of motivation available today, that aims to promote students’ curiosity in learning. The purpose of this article is to make an overview of learning motivation from a SDT perspective.
